I suppose my problem with First Premier Bank Card is rather different from majority posted here. I never applied for a credit card from First Premier and never had a desire for one. My credit reports from TransUnion and Experian show 156 "Accounts in Good Standing" and 1 "Potentially Negative Items." I have in all those 156 good acounts have every one maked paid on time and quite frankly I have never paid in 50+ years any bill be it house mortgage, car loan, credit cards, etc. none have ever been late.

So I suppose one would ask how did a person like me ever get mixed-up with First Premier who as I have investigated really lends to less than credit worth folks. Answer is someone applied in my name and at some point go ahold of my SSN etc. To my amazement First Premier Bank Card does not have a phone verification system in place. They send you the card even to a bogus address ready to use. They only way you find out is when First Premier Bank Card starts calling you saying you are overdue. Of course the bills etc are sent to the address the card was sent.

I found out that TransUnion made it know to First Premier Bank Card that the address this card was being sent was a new/never lived at address. Since I had be at the previous address for 21 years TransUnion shot a "red flag" up to First Premier. They paid no attention and they were quite frankly so tickled to get their clutches on person of such high credit standing they sent it out probably rubbing their hand together saying "Boy or Boy."

I am dealing with this case of identity theft and I can say that in five letters to First Premier including 2 to CEO (Myles Beacon) and their head of corporate communications (Ms Julie Gilson) not one yes NOT ONE of those letters has been answered. I have made at least 5 phone calls to them and have dealt with a very nice supervisor to rude and arrogant customer service clerks one of which hung up on me because she was cornered in having to say we are at fault.

I have researched First Premier Bank Card her at this website and I am appauled at the number of complaints and really scary horror stories told. I have researched the State of Ohio Attorney General's website and I found over 71 complaints on First Premier Bank Card from account posting to bill collection to heavy handed tactics on the phone.

My advice to those who are having problems to be proactive and aggressive in your dealing with First Premier. I have tactive investigations underway with the attorney generals of both South Dakota and Ohio, local police department where the card was mailed, county sheriff where card was mailed, South Dakota Division of Banking, BBB in South Dakota/Nebraska, three credit reporting agencies (TransUnion, Experian, Equifax), American Banking Association, my US Congressman, and have written to the chairs of the House and Senate Banking Committees dealing with financial institutions ethics.

First Premier is moving and maybe a bit faster than they would like to move because of the number and the levels of these investigative agencies. In one instance First Premier even refused me information on the dates and locations of the charges and within 24 hours they had a court order in their office to comply from the authorities.

Quite honestly now First Premier Bank Card is trying to come off to all the agencies as being active, aggressive, the hurt party, etc. but everyone knows the reputation of this outfit. They have more complaints as to banking ethics than any other bank in South Dakota.

#2 Author of original report

Contacted Today by TransUnion Credit Reporting Agency

AUTHOR: Robert - (U.S.A.)

POSTED: Tuesday, August 07, 2007

I was this morning contacted by TransUnion Credit Reporting Agency that all negative information contained on my credit history report from First Premier Bank Card had been removed. They said an updated copy of my credit report was available on line and would also be mailed to me.

They apologized for any inconvenience this had caused and said the blame for this incorrect information lies with First Premier Bank Card. They also directed me to the Federal Trade Commission website and said you do have other rights and you may take legal action against First Premier Bank Card for any negative actions that resulted when this obviously incorrect information was placed on your account. Since my brother is a corporate attorney that sounds like free legal services. Its time First Premier was held accountable for these messes.

#1 Author of original report

Little More Clarification on Original Posting

AUTHOR: Robert - (U.S.A.)

POSTED: Sunday, August 05, 2007

Wanted to clarify a few statements made in the original posting:

Since establishing credit back at age 21 some 38 y.o. later I have a credit report from TransUnion, Experian and Equifax that show 156 credit history filings. Every one of those are "Account in Good Standing." Every single one shows "Paid/Never late." The only negative posting in each credit report under "Potentially negative items or items for further review" as the posting of First Premier Bank in which it shows this fraudulent card issued by them without any safeguard activation was "closed/Past due 30 days. Account closed at credit grantor's request." You can not imagine how absolutely livid I was when I saw that and when I called First Premier Bank Customer Service Rep.

Then add to it this. I get the first credit report (I requested it) from TransUnion in which it shows where First Premier Bank mails this fraudulent card. I am the following day in the police station of the city where it was mailed and meeting with two uniformed officers and a police detective. The detective is ready to pull video tape of the sales made at stores illegal charges were made and they need times and dates of the charges. I called First Premier from the police station in the presence of the 3 police officers. First Premier Bank Card refuses to give me dates and times of the charges. CAN YOU BELIEVE THAT !!!
